Ticket: Missed pick-up — sealed exam papers

The scheduled collection of sealed examination papers from Thornby Hall for delivery to the Westmere Assessment Centre did not occur this morning; the courier never arrived at the loading entrance. The papers remain in the secure cabinet under dual custody and must not be released without proper verification. A replacement pick-up has been arranged for tomorrow at 08:30. Receiving site staff should prepare the chain-of-custody log in advance. The courier hand-over must follow this instruction:

handover note for bajog-tawig: the lamion quenael courier leaves the wendor ledger at gate 1289 under passcode 760784

## Authentication

Quick version for support: the Renderloft transcoding farm checks a service key on every job submission and status call. No key, no queue — you'll just get a 401 and a grumpy log line. Keys are scoped per environment, so don't mix staging and prod, or jobs will silently land in the wrong farm. For prod support lookups, use the key below.

gateway credential: kto3_qfe

## Releases

Welcome aboard! Quieten, our on-call alert deduplicator, ships every other Thursday. We cut a tag from main, run the smoke suite against the Farwick staging cluster, and push artifacts to the internal registry. If you're doing the release, ping whoever's on rotation first — usually Marla or Deet — so nobody double-cuts. Hotfixes skip the schedule but still need a signed build; unsigned tarballs get rejected at deploy time, no exceptions. To verify any release artifact locally, use the current signing key below.

signing key of yagug-bawif = bky9_cvCf6ehGp